Defining Attributes
Definition
Percentage of patients who selected each response option for the question What were the main reasons for the delay? out of (multiple choice)I had to wait for medicines; I had to wait to see a health professional; I had to wait for an ambulance or hospital transport; I had to wait for the discharge letter; I had to wait for test results; I had to wait for a bed in a ward; Some other reason.
Numerator
The (weighted) number of survey respondents who selected the most positive response option:
Denominator
The (weighted) number of survey respondents who selected any of the response options to the question, minus exclusions.
Exclusions
Response: Don't know/can't remember.
Use of Risk Adjustment
Risk Adjustments
Responses were weighted to match the population by stay type (same day or overnight) and age group within each hospital.
Stratifications
By facility.

Data Collection Methods
Monthly sample sizes calculated at the facility level based on data extracted from the HIE for the previous 12 month period. Where patients had multiple visits within the sampling month, their most recent ED visit was retained for sampling. Christmas and New Year period deemed to be an non-typical period of emergency care service provision and therefore excluded.
